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"mainstream retail"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to refer to widely accepted or popular retail practices, stores, or products that appeal to the general public. Example: "The rise of online shopping has significantly impacted mainstream retail, forcing many brick-and-mortar stores to adapt."

FAQs
What does "mainstream retail" mean?
"Mainstream retail" refers to established and widely accepted retail practices, stores, and products that are popular among the general public. It represents the conventional methods of selling goods and services to a broad consumer base.
What are some examples of "mainstream retail"?
Examples of "mainstream retail" include large department stores, supermarkets, chain stores, and widely used e-commerce platforms. These retailers typically offer a diverse range of products and cater to a large customer base.
What are some alternatives to using the phrase "mainstream retail"?
Depending on the context, you can use alternatives like "conventional retail", "traditional retail sector", or "established retail market".
How does "mainstream retail" differ from niche retail?
"Mainstream retail" focuses on appealing to a broad consumer base with widely popular products, while niche retail caters to specific interests or specialized markets with more targeted offerings.
